What was once the first school house in North
Dakots is nowa bed and breakfast. Built in the early 1800's,
this school burned and left a cigar smoking Superintendent
and a young boy in its ashes. Described as a large man with
bushy hair and a piercing stare, he smoked cigars as he
went from the foyer to every corner of the building. It
was during one of these tours that the superintendent was
killed while minding the coal-burning boiler in the basement.
According to legend the thing caught fire and he and a young
student died. The school functioned until the state and
student population outgrew its walls.
There are no records that indicate its use over the next
few years, but by the early 1990's the old building sat
empty. An investment group that promised to bring visitors
once again into its hallways and to preserve the historic
site saved it from decay.
In 1996 Jacqueline Fix and Brad Mincher reopened the old
schoolhouse as a bed and breakfast. Before the doors opened,
however, they had many renovations to make and it was during
this time that the new owners first started noticing strange
things were afoot in their house.
When they began to tear down walls and doing repairs the
paranormal events started happening. Objects would vanish
and reappear in strange places and workmen would hear strange
moaning and groaning. Lights began to flicker on and off.
The smell of cigar smoke was strong even though none of
the workers smoked cigars. One workman going down into the
cellar claimed to see and smell cigar smoke and swore there
was no one. Toilets flush on their own and cold spots that
occasionally float through the house. According to the owners
there is also a peculiar light that appears in the lower
basement room where the coal-fired boiler used to be. They
try to avoid the room because, in their words, it is "creepy."
There are several unsubstantiated reports
from former guests about the apparitions, but the most compelling
sightings come from the owners themselves. On several occasions
she has seen the darting figures, just out of the corner
of her eye.
Witnesses say they feel they are watched and there are cold
spots and hair stands up on end leaving an unexplained tingling.
Everything about the old building seems peaceful. But in
the hallway is the hint of cigar smoke despite the strict
non-smoking rule. Bags and furniture sometimes move or are
simply not in the place where they left them.
